Magnussen pleased with second points-finish

Kevin Magnussen / Renault Kevin Magnussen enjoyed his second highest finish of the season after seeing the cherquered flag tenth in the Singapore Grand Prix. The Renault driver started the race from P15 and took advantage of the chaotic start, running for most of the race inside the top ten. “I’m very happy for the whole team as this must be a boost for all of us. It’s been a very demanding season as we all want to score points at every race, but that’s not been possible. Nevertheless we all keep fighting and a result like this shows why we fight and why we never give up. “The team nailed it with the strategy, with the start and with the balance of the car.
